#!/usr/bin/env ruby
require "#{File.dirname(__FILE__)}/optparse"
require "#{File.dirname(__FILE__)}/dependencies"
class Installer
include RubyEnterpriseEdition
ROOT = File.expand_path(File.dirname(__FILE__))
PASSENGER_WEBSITE = "http://www.modrails.com"
EMM_RUBY_WEBSITE = "http://www.rubyenterpriseedition.com"
REQUIRED_DEPENDENCIES = [
Dependencies::CC,
Dependencies::CXX,
Dependencies::Zlib_Dev,
Dependencies::OpenSSL_Dev,
Dependencies::Readline_Dev
]
def start(options = {})
Dir.chdir(ROOT)
@version = File.read("version.txt")
@auto_install_prefix = options[:prefix]
@destdir = strip_trailing_slashes(options[:destdir])
@install_useful_gems = options[:install_useful_gems]
@use_tcmalloc = options[:tcmalloc]
@enable_continuations = options[:enable_continuations]
if !options[:extra_configure_args].empty?
@extra_configure_args = options[:extra_configure_args].join(" ")
end
if RUBY_PLATFORM =~ /darwin/
ENV['PATH'] = "#{ENV['PATH']}:/usr/local/mysql/bin"
end
show_welcome_screen
check_dependencies || exit(1)
ask_installation_prefix
steps = []
if tcmalloc_supported?
steps += [
:configure_tcmalloc,
:compile_tcmalloc,
:install_tcmalloc
]
end
steps += [
:configure_ruby,
:compile_system_allocator,
:compile_ruby,
:install_ruby,
:install_ree_specific_binaries,
:install_rubygems,
:install_iconv
]
steps.each do |step|
if !self.send(step)
exit 1
end
end
install_useful_libraries
show_finalization_screen
ensure
reset_terminal_colors
end
private
def show_welcome_screen
color_puts "<banner>Welcome to the Ruby Enterprise Edition installer</banner>"
color_puts "This installer will help you install Ruby Enterprise Edition #{@version}."
color_puts "Don't worry, none of your system files will be touched if you don't want them"
color_puts "to, so there is no risk that things will screw up."
puts
color_puts "You can expect this from the installation process:"
puts
color_puts " <b>1.</b> Ruby Enterprise Edition will be compiled and optimized for speed for this"
color_puts " system."
color_puts " <b>2.</b> Ruby on Rails will be installed for Ruby Enterprise Edition."
color_puts " <b>3.</b> You will learn how to tell Phusion Passenger to use Ruby Enterprise"
color_puts " Edition instead of regular Ruby."
puts
color_puts "<b>Press Enter to continue, or Ctrl-C to abort.</b>"
wait
end
def check_dependencies
missing_dependencies = []
color_puts "<banner>Checking for required software...</banner>"
puts
REQUIRED_DEPENDENCIES.each do |dep|
color_print " * #{dep.name}... "
result = dep.check
if result.found?
if result.found_at
color_puts "<green>found at #{result.found_at}</green>"
else
color_puts "<green>found</green>"
end
else
color_puts "<red>not found</red>"
missing_dependencies << dep
end
end
if missing_dependencies.empty?
return true
else
puts
color_puts "<red>Some required software is not installed.</red>"
color_puts "But don't worry, this installer will tell you how to install them.\n"
color_puts "<b>Press Enter to continue, or Ctrl-C to abort.</b>"
wait
line
color_puts "<banner>Installation instructions for required software</banner>"
puts
missing_dependencies.each do |dep|
print_dependency_installation_instructions(dep)
puts
end
return false
end
end
def print_dependency_installation_instructions(dep)
color_puts " * To install <yellow>#{dep.name}</yellow>:"
if !dep.install_command.nil?
color_puts " Please run <b>#{dep.install_command}</b> as root."
elsif !dep.install_instructions.nil?
color_puts " " << dep.install_instructions
elsif !dep.website.nil?
color_puts " Please download it from <b>#{dep.website}</b>"
if !dep.website_comments.nil?
color_puts " (#{dep.website_comments})"
end
else
color_puts " Search Google."
end
end
def strip_trailing_slashes(data)
if data.nil?
return nil
else
result = data.sub(/\/+$/, '')
if result.empty? && !data.empty?
return '/'
else
return result
end
end
end
def ask_installation_prefix
line
color_puts "<banner>Target directory</banner>"
puts
@old_prefix = File.read("source/.prefix.txt") rescue nil
if @auto_install_prefix
@prefix = @auto_install_prefix
puts "Auto-installing to: #{@prefix}"
else
puts "Where would you like to install Ruby Enterprise Edition to?"
puts "(All Ruby Enterprise Edition files will be put inside that directory.)"
puts
@prefix = query_directory(@old_prefix || "/opt/ruby-enterprise-#{@version}")
end
@prefix = strip_trailing_slashes(@prefix)
@prefix_changed = @prefix != @old_prefix
File.open("source/.prefix.txt", "w") do |f|
f.write(@prefix)
end
if @destdir && !@destdir =~ /\/$/
@destdir += "/"
end
ENV['CPATH'] = "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/include:/usr/include:/usr/local/include:#{ENV['CPATH']}"
ENV['LD_LIBRARY_PATH'] = "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ib:#{ENV['LD_LIBRARY_PATH']}"
ENV['D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H'] = "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ib:#{ENV['D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H']}"
end
def configure_tcmalloc
return configure_autoconf_package('source/distro/google-perftools-1.3',
'the memory allocator for Ruby Enterprise Edition',
'--disable-dependency-tracking')
end
def compile_tcmalloc
Dir.chdir('source/distro/google-perftools-1.3') do
return sh("make libtcmalloc_minimal.la")
end
end
def install_tcmalloc
return install_autoconf_package('source/distro/google-perftools-1.3',
'the memory allocator for Ruby Enterprise Edition') do
sh("mkdir", "-p", "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ib") &&
# Remove existing .so files so that the copy operation doesn't
# overwrite the existing files in-place. Overwriting shared
# libraries in-place can cause existing processes that use
# those libraries to crash.
sh("rm -rf '#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ib'/libtcmalloc_minimal*.#{PlatformInfo::LIBEXT}*") &&
sh("cp -Rpf .libs/libtcmalloc_minimal*.#{PlatformInfo::LIBEXT}* '#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ib/'")
end
end
def configure_ruby
return configure_autoconf_package('source', 'Ruby Enterprise Edition',
"#{@extra_configure_args} CFLAGS='-g -O2 -fno-stack-protector'")
end
def compile_system_allocator
if platform_uses_two_level_namespace_for_dynamic_libraries?
Dir.chdir("source") do
@using_system_allocator_library = true
# On platforms that use a two-level symbol namespace for
# dynamic libraries (most notably MacOS X), integrating
# tcmalloc requires a special library. See system_allocator.c
# for more information.
ENV['D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H'] = "#{ROOT}/source:#{ENV['D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H']}"
return sh("#{PlatformInfo::CC} #{ENV['CFLAGS']} #{ENV['LDFLAGS']} -dynamiclib system_allocator.c -install_name @rpath/libsystem_allocator.dylib -o libsystem_allocator.dylib")
end
else
return true
end
end
def compile_ruby
Dir.chdir("source") do
if continuations_patch_applied?
if !@enable_continuations
sh "patch -p1 -R < ../continuations.patch"
end
else
if @enable_continuations
sh "patch -p1 < ../continuations.patch"
end
end
# No idea why, but sometimes 'make' fails unless we do this.
sh("mkdir -p .ext/common")
makefile = File.read('Makefile')
if makefile !~ /\$\(PRELIBS\)/
makefile.sub!(/^LIBS = (.*)$/, 'LIBS = $(PRELIBS) \1')
File.open('Makefile', 'w') do |f|
f.write(makefile)
end
end
prelibs = "-Wl,"
if PlatformInfo.solaris_ld?
prelibs << "-R#{@prefix}/lib"
else
prelibs << "-rpath,#{@prefix}/lib"
end
prelibs << " -L#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ib"
if tcmalloc_supported?
prelibs << " -ltcmalloc_minimal "
end
if platform_uses_two_level_namespace_for_dynamic_libraries?
prelibs << " -lsystem_allocator"
end
return sh("make PRELIBS='#{prelibs}'")
end
end
def install_ruby
if install_autoconf_package('source', 'Ruby Enterprise Edition')
# Some installed files may have wrong permissions
# (not world-readable). So we fix this.
if sh("chmod -R g+r,o+r,o-w #{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ib/ruby")
if @using_system_allocator_library &&
!sh("install source/libsystem_allocator.dylib #{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ib/")
return false
else
return true
end
else
return false
end
else
return false
end
end
def install_ree_specific_binaries
File.open("#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/ree-version", 'w') do |f|
f.puts("#!/bin/sh")
f.puts("echo 'Ruby Enterprise Edition version #{@version}'")
end
system("chmod +x '#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/ree-version'")
end
def install_rubygems
# We might be installing into a fakeroot, so add the fakeroot's library
# search paths to RUBYLIB so that gem installation will work.
basedir = "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ib/ruby"
libdir = "#{basedir}/1.8"
archname = File.basename(File.dirname(Dir["#{libdir}/*/thread.#{PlatformInfo::RUBYLIBEXT}"].first))
extlibdir = "#{libdir}/#{archname}"
site_libdir = "#{basedir}/site_ruby/1.8"
site_extlibdir = "#{site_libdir}/#{archname}"
ENV['RUBYLIB'] = "#{libdir}:#{extlibdir}:#{site_libdir}:#{site_extlibdir}"
Dir.chdir("rubygems") do
line
color_puts "<banner>Installing RubyGems...</banner>"
if !sh("#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/ruby", "setup.rb", "--no-ri", "--no-rdoc")
puts "*** Cannot install RubyGems"
return false
end
end
return true
end
def install_iconv
# On some systems, most notably FreeBSD, the iconv extension isn't
# correctly installed. So here we do it manually.
Dir.chdir('source/ext/iconv') do
# 'make clean' must be run, because sometimes 'make'
# thinks iconv.so is already compiled even though it
# isn't.
if !sh("#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/ruby", "extconf.rb") ||
!sh("make clean") ||
!sh("make") ||
# For some reason DESTDIR is not necessary here;
# not sure why.
!sh("make install")
puts "*** Cannot install the iconv extension"
return false
end
end
return true
end
def install_useful_libraries
line
color_puts "<banner>Installing useful libraries...</banner>"
gem = "#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/ruby #{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in/gem"
mysql_config = PlatformInfo.find_command('mysql_config')
if mysql_config
mysql_gem = "mysql -- --with-mysql-config='#{mysql_config}'"
else
mysql_gem = "mysql"
end
gem_names = []
if @install_useful_gems
gem_names += ["passenger", "rake", "rails", "fastthread",
"rack", mysql_gem, "sqlite3-ruby", "postgres"]
end
failed_gems = []
if sh("#{gem} sources --update")
gem_names.each do |gem_name|
color_puts "\n<b>Installing #{gem_name}...</b>"
if !sh("#{gem} install -r --no-rdoc --no-ri --no-update-sources --backtrace #{gem_name}")
failed_gems << gem_name
end
end
else
failed_gems = gem_names
end
if !failed_gems.empty?
line
color_puts "<banner>Warning: some libraries could not be installed</banner>"
color_puts "The following gems could not be installed, probably because of an Internet"
color_puts "connection error:"
puts
failed_gems.each do |gem_name|
color_puts " <b>* #{gem_name}</b>"
end
puts
color_puts "These gems are not required, i.e. Ruby Enterprise Edition will work fine without them. But most people use Ruby Enterprise Edition in combination with Phusion Passenger and Ruby on Rails, which do require one or more of the aforementioned gems, so you may want to install them later."
puts
color_puts "To install the aforementioned gems, please use the following commands:"
failed_gems.each do |gem_name|
color_puts " <yellow>* #{gem} install #{gem_name}</yellow>"
end
puts
color_puts "<b>Press ENTER to show the next screen.</b>"
wait
end
# Fix the shebang lines of scripts in 'bin' folder.
fix_shebang_lines("#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/bin", "#{@prefix}/bin/ruby")
Dir.chdir("#{@destdir}#{@prefix}/lib/ruby/gems/1.8/gems") do
if !Dir["sqlite3-ruby*"].empty?
# The sqlite3-ruby gem installs files with wrong
# permissions. We fix this.
sh "chmod -R g+r,o+r,o-w sqlite3-ruby*"
end
end
end
def show_finalization_screen
line
color_puts "<banner>Ruby Enterprise Edition is successfully installed!</banner>"
color_puts "If want to use <yellow>Phusion Passenger (#{PASSENGER_WEBSITE})</yellow> in combination"
color_puts "with Ruby Enterprise Edition, then you must reinstall Phusion Passenger against"
color_puts "Ruby Enterprise Edition, as follows:"
puts
color_puts " <b>#{@prefix}/bin/passenger-install-apache2-module</b>"
puts
color_puts "Make sure you don't forget to paste the Apache configuration directives that"
color_puts "the installer gives you."
puts
puts
color_puts "If you ever want to uninstall Ruby Enterprise Edition, simply remove this"
color_puts "directory:"
puts
color_puts " <b>#{@prefix}</b>"
puts
color_puts "If you have any questions, feel free to visit our website:"
puts
color_puts " <b>#{EMM_RUBY_WEBSITE}</b>"
puts
color_puts "Enjoy Ruby Enterprise Edition, a product of <yellow>Phusion (www.phusion.nl)</yellow> :-)"
end
private
D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S = "\e[0m\e[37m\e[40m"
def color_puts(message)
puts substitute_color_tags(message)
end
def color_print(message)
print substitute_color_tags(message)
end
def substitute_color_tags(data)
data = data.gsub(%r{<b>(.*?)</b>}m, "\e[1m\\1#{D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S}")
data.gsub!(%r{<red>(.*?)</red>}m, "\e[1m\e[31m\\1#{D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S}")
data.gsub!(%r{<green>(.*?)</green>}m, "\e[1m\e[32m\\1#{D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S}")
data.gsub!(%r{<yellow>(.*?)</yellow>}m, "\e[1m\e[33m\\1#{D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S}")
data.gsub!(%r{<banner>(.*?)</banner>}m, "\e[33m\e[44m\e[1m\\1#{DEFAULT_TERMINAL_COLORS}")
return data
end
def reset_terminal_colors
STDOUT.write("\e[0m")
STDOUT.flush
end
def line
puts "--------------------------------------------"
end
def wait
if !@auto_install_prefix
STDIN.readline
end
rescue Interrupt
exit 2
end
def query_directory(default = "")
while true
STDOUT.write("[#{default}] : ")
STDOUT.flush
input = STDIN.readline.strip
if input.empty?
return default
elsif input !~ /^\//
color_puts "<red>Please specify an absolute directory.</red>"
elsif input =~ /\s/
color_puts "<red>The directory name may not contain spaces.</red>"
else
return input
end
end
rescue Interrupt, EOFError
exit 2
end
def tcmalloc_supported?
return @use_tcmalloc &&
RUBY_PLATFORM !~ /solaris/ &&
RUBY_PLATFORM !~ /openbsd/ &&
RUBY_PLATFORM !~ /arm/
end
def platform_uses_two_level_namespace_for_dynamic_libraries?
return RUBY_PLATFORM =~ /darwin/
end
def sh(*command)
puts command.join(' ')
return system(*command)
end
def configure_autoconf_package(dir, name, configure_options = nil)
line
color_puts "<banner>Compiling and optimizing #{name}</banner>"
color_puts "In the mean time, feel free to grab a cup of coffee.\n\n"
Dir.chdir(dir) do
# If nothing has been compiled yet, then set the timestamps of the files
# to some time in the past. I think the "/" directory's timestamp is
# guaranteed to be in the past.
# This prevents 'configure' and 'make' from thinking that the 'configure'
# script must be regenerated, for computers that have the clock wrongly
# configured or computers that are in a different time zone than the
# computer the REE tarball was created on.
if Dir["*.o"].empty?
system("touch -r / *")
if File.directory?("m4")
system("touch -r / m4/*")
end
end
if @prefix_changed || !File.exist?("Makefile")
if !sh("./configure --prefix=#{@prefix} #{configure_options}")
return false
end
else
color_puts "<green>It looks like the source is already configured.</green>"
color_puts "<green>Skipping configure script...</green>"
end
return true
end
end
def install_autoconf_package(dir, name)
Dir.chdir(dir) do
if block_given?
result = yield
else
result = sh("make install DESTDIR='#{@destdir}'")
end
if result
return true
else
puts
line
color_puts "<red>Cannot install #{name}</red>"
puts
color_puts "This installer was able to compile #{name}, but could not " <<
"install the files to <b>#{@destdir}#{@prefix}</b>."
puts
if Process.uid == 0
color_puts "This installer probably doesn't have permission " <<
"to write to that folder, even though it's running as " <<
"root. Please fix the permissions, and re-run this installer."
else
color_puts "This installer probably doesn't have permission to " <<
"write to that folder, because it's running as " <<
"<b>#{`whoami`.strip}</b>. Please re-run this installer " <<
"as <b>root</b>."
end
return false
end
end
end
# Fix the shebang lines of Ruby scripts.
def fix_shebang_lines(dir, new_shebang_line)
Dir.foreach(dir) do |basename|
next if basename =~ /^\./
filename = File.join(dir, basename)
begin
next if !File.executable?(filename)
rest = nil
File.open(filename, 'rb') do |f|
shebang = f.readline
if shebang =~ /ruby/
puts "Updating #{filename}..."
rest = f.read
end
end
if rest
tempfile = "#{filename}.tmp.#{Process.pid}"
File.open(tempfile, 'w') do |f|
f.write("#!#{new_shebang_line}\n")
f.write(rest)
end
File.chmod(File.stat(filename).mode, tempfile)
File.rename(tempfile, filename)
rest.replace("")
end
rescue SystemCallError, IOError => e
STDERR.puts "*** ERROR: #{e}"
end
end
end
def continuations_patch_applied?
File.read("eval.c") !~ /PROT_EMPTY/
end
end
options = { :tcmalloc => true, :install_useful_gems => true, :extra_configure_args => [] }
parser = OptionParser.new do |opts|
newline = "\n#{' ' * 37}"
opts.banner = "Usage: installer [options]"
opts.separator("")
opts.on("-a", "--auto PREFIX", String,
"Configure Ruby with prefix PREFIX and#{newline}" <<
"install it without any user interaction.") do |dir|
options[:prefix] = dir
end
opts.on("--destdir DIR", String,
"Install everthing under the given#{newline}" <<
"destination directory. Used when building#{newline}" <<
"packages for Ruby Enterprise Edition.") do |dir|
options[:destdir] = dir
end
opts.on("-c", "--configure-arg ARG", String,
"Pass an extra argument to the Ruby#{newline}" <<
"configure script. You can specify this#{newline}" <<
"option multiple times to pass multiple#{newline}" <<
"arguments.") do |arg|
options[:extra_configure_args] << arg
end
opts.on("--dont-install-useful-gems",
"Do not install a few useful gems that are#{newline}" <<
"normally installed as well: passenger,#{newline}" <<
"rails, mysql, etc.") do
options[:install_useful_gems] = false
end
opts.on("--no-tcmalloc", "Do not install tcmalloc support.") do
options[:tcmalloc] = false
end
opts.on("--enable-continuations", "Enable support for continuations.") do
options[:enable_continuations] = true
end
opts.on("-h", "--help", "Show this message.") do
puts opts
exit
end
end
begin
parser.parse!
rescue OptionParser::ParseError => e
puts e
puts
puts "Please see '--help' for valid options."
exit 1
end
Installer.new.start(options)
